      <description>&lt;h1 id=&#34;what-is-the-mergado-notifications-extension&#34;&gt;&lt;strong&gt;What is the Mergado Notifications extension?&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;a class=&#34;anchor&#34; href=&#34;#what-is-the-mergado-notifications-extension&#34;&gt;#&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/h1&gt;&#xA;&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Mergado Notifications&lt;/strong&gt; is an extension that forwards &lt;strong&gt;alerts from Mergado directly to your communication platform&lt;/strong&gt;. Its main purpose is to deliver the notifications you see under the bell icon in the Mergado admin or by email to the &lt;strong&gt;channels you use for team communication&lt;/strong&gt; (Rocket.Chat or Slack). This means you don&amp;rsquo;t need to regularly visit the Mergado interface to find out whether something important has happened in your projects.&lt;/p&gt;</description>
